The Srebrenica municipal census commission said that the census is being carried out in this area according to plan. Enumerators have determined the dynamics of work with their instructors, they are on the field and are doing the job for which they signed a contract. The only thing that is slowing down their work are census materials, and the decision by the RS Agency for Statistics and the Census Bureau regarding the enumerators who violated the Census Law.
‘’We lack forms P1 and P2, but we expect to have them by the end of the day. Regarding the eventual repetition of the census in several census circles, we still have not received any information, so the Census Commission was not informed by the RS Agency for Statistics nor by the Census Bureau. For days, we have been trying and looking for the decision from the Census Bureau to dismiss an enumerator who was filling out forms in a café. However, we have never received that decision, and how we would continue to act in accordance with the decision. When it comes to the case of an enumerator who tried to cross the border into Serbia with census forms, we requested advice yesterday from the RS Agency for Statistics on what steps to take’’, said the President of the municipal census commission Nermina Muminović for ‘Sarajevo Times’.
Even though some places are far from the area of municipality Srebrenica, enumerators are arriving at these destinations and are successfully carrying out the census. People are friendly and happy to open the door for enumerators, said the Srebrenica municipal census commission.
